A moderate earthquake magnitude 5 (ml/mb) has struck on Sunday, 104 kilometers (65 miles) from Yamada in Japan. The 5-magnitude earthquake has occurred at 09:16:58 / 9:16 am (local time epicenter). Exact location, longitude 143.1519° East, latitude 39.3484° North, depth = 10 km. Global date and time of event UTC/GMT: 09/11/25 / 2025-11-09 09:16:58 / November 9, 2025 @ 9:16 am. The epicenter was at a depth of 10 km (6 miles). A tsunami warning has not been issued (Does not indicate if a tsunami actually did or will exist). Unique identifier: us6000rmf3. Epicenter of the event was 104 km (65 miles) from Yamada (c. 20 100 pop). Closest city/cities or villages, with min 5000 pop, to hypocenter/epicentrum was Yamada. Nearby country/countries that might be effected, Japan (c. 127 288 000 pop).
In the past 24 hours, there have been nineteen, in the last 10 days twenty-eight, in the past 30 days thirty and in the last 365 days fifty-seven ear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that have been detected in the same area. Every year there are an estimated 1320 moderate earthquakes in the world. Earthquakes 5.0 to 6.0 may cause light damage to buildings and other structures.
